With dental insurance, your annual cleansings are constantly mosting likely to cost you much less than a dental filling or origin canal, but do you understand why? Your insurance coverage categorizes oral procedures into 3 main groups-- precautionary, basic, as well as major dental solutions-- based upon just how complicated as well as pricey they are. Where a solution falls within these levels will determine just how much of it is covered.

If a condition needing treatment is found during a screening, the state needs to give the needed solutions to deal with that problem, whether or not such services are included in a state's Medicaid strategy. Each state is called for to create an oral periodicity schedule in consultation with identified oral organizations entailed in child healthcare.




 


Oral services need to be supplied at periods that meet practical criteria of oral practice, and at such other intervals, as shown by medical need, to figure out this page the presence of a thought illness or problem. States need to speak with identified dental organizations associated with kid wellness care to develop those intervals.




The Of 10 Best Dentists In Albuquerque




The periodicity schedule for various other EPSDT solutions may not regulate the schedule for dental services. States that offer CHIP protection to youngsters with a Medicaid expansion program are called for to offer the EPSDT advantage. Dental insurance coverage in different CHIP programs is called for to consist of coverage for dental services "required to avoid illness and advertise dental wellness, bring back dental frameworks to health and feature, and treat emergency situation conditions." States with a different CHIP program may pick from 2 choices for giving oral protection: a bundle of dental benefits that satisfies the CHIP needs, or a benchmark dental advantage bundle.


States are likewise required to upload a listing of all taking part Medicaid and also CHIP oral providers as well as benefit packages on . States have adaptability to identify what dental benefits are provided to adult Medicaid enrollees. While most states provide a minimum of emergency oral solutions for adults, much less than half of the states presently give thorough oral care.

The very first point dental experts frequently inspect for throughout a dental appointment is any kind of signs of tooth degeneration. Naturally, cavities that establish on extra visible teeth in the front of the mouth are simple to see, but tooth cavities on teeth additionally back in the mouth often go unnoticed. Dental practitioners also find any type of indicators of damaged enamel, and also they can provide treatment to assist individuals stay clear of creating cavities.

 

 

 

Getting The Root Canals In Charlotte Nc To Work


Periodontal disease is really common and influences countless individuals each year. If left undetected and also neglected, gum illness might cause more significant dental health and wellness problems, including gum tissue recession, dental infections and ultimate tooth loss. During an oral examination, dental practitioners search for any kind of signs of gum tissue disease, such as inflamed gum tissues, discoloration of the gum tissues and periodontal economic crisis.

An oral abscess establishes when a pocket of pus types either in the periodontals or at the base of a tooth. A periodontal abscess can create as a result of neglected periodontal disease.




Expectant females are specifically prone to gum inflammation. Signs of an abscess may include a bubble of pus that created around the contaminated location. Sudden, extreme discomfort in the location near the influenced periodontal or tooth may additionally signify an abscess. The discomfort could click this site be pain as well as might be worse when a person relaxes on one side.

 

 

 

The Single Strategy To Use For Metlife Dental


A comply with up extensive dental therapy to get rid of the issue that has created the infection in the very first place will be needed. In many cases, emergency situation dental extraction may be called for, or a dental professional may need to execute an origin canal treatment. Abscesses are simply one instance of a dental infection (emergency dentist near me).


Advanced periodontal disease, or periodontitis, is one example of an infection that can turn right into an emergency situation. If not dealt with rapidly, the infection can cause the teeth to end up being loose, as the bone that sustains them deteriorates. Some people also experience tooth loss as an outcome of untreated advanced gum tissue disease.
